Why Study Human Biology?

Human Biology integrates life sciences with human-centric applications, covering everything from disease mechanisms to behavioral genetics. Students study core topics like neurobiology and immunology, preparing for academia or industry. A unique anecdote: faculty at the University of California pioneered studies on human chronobiology, revealing jet lag's genetic underpinnings in the 1990s.

Salary Expectations and Trends

Biology professors average $97,500 (BLS 2023), with Human Biology specialists earning $85,000-$120,000 for assistants, up to $160,000+ for full professors. Trends show 8% growth by 2032, boosted by health tech. Locale quirks: California salaries hit $130k median due to biotech hubs.
